## Formula sandbox tuning

User-supplied formulas in Gridmoor execute inside a restricted interpreter with hard ceilings on time, memory, and call depth. Reviewers should confirm any change to these ceilings is justified in the PR description, since raising them widens the abuse surface. Defaults were chosen from production traces. The current limits are as follows.

limits module of tafog-fawip:
WEIGHTS = {
    "julix": 57,
    "lamys": 992,
    "kasvan": 209,
    "quenok": 750,
    "alddor": 259,
    "oliath": 1009,
    "wenix": 815,
}

## Local Setup

FuelTally generates weekly fuel-usage reports for the Brindlewood delivery fleet. Plugin authors should clone the repo, run `make seed` to load sample odometer and pump data, then start the report worker with `make dev`. The worker expects a reachable reporting database. Point your plugin at the connection string below.

database URL for haduf-tajof: redis://holox_svc:c9@db-3fb6.lumicworks.local:5432/fraeth

### Encoding Detection — Textgate Intake

For the weekly sync: uploaded files pass through Textgate's charset sniffer before parsing. It samples the first 64KB, falls back to UTF-8 with replacement on ambiguity, and logs confidence scores to the Intake dashboard. To query those scores yourself, call the internal metrics endpoint authenticated with the team key, which is provided below.

API key for yahig-tadup: kto7_ubizbYm